I combined BasicGrey Two Scoops designer paper with DeNami Design's five-scoops ice cream cone for some birthday fun.
The main image was watercolored. The cherry and the little hearts on the vanilla scoop were colored with a Rocket Red Galaxy Marker and then all of the scoops and the cherry were covered with either Star Dust Stickles or Crystal Effects. Can you see the Sparkle Gems on the left side of the horizontal circle strips? They're light pink and green in real life.
